Web1 feb. 2010 · Figure 1. a) Configuration and (b) photographic view of the direct laser lithographic system. Figure 1 (a) shows the configuration of typical direct laser lithographic system, which includes (1) the intensity stabilization and control part, (2) the writing head with autofocusing mechanism, and (3) the moving part. The term “graphic design” first appeared in a 1922 essay by William Addison Dwiggins called “New Kind of Printing Calls for New Design.”. As a book designer, Dwiggins coined the term to explain how he organized and managed visuals in his works.
